Trust in human-robot interaction

Contributor(s): Nam, Chang S | Lyons, Joseph BMaterial type: TextTextPublication details: London Academic Press 2021 Description: xxv, 588 pISBN: 9780128194720Subject(s): Human-robot interaction | TrustDDC classification: 629.8924019 Summary: Trust in Human-Robot Interaction addresses the gamut of factors that influence trust of robotic systems. The book presents the theory, fundamentals, techniques and diverse applications of the behavioral, cognitive and neural mechanisms of trust in human-robot interaction, covering topics like individual differences, transparency, communication, physical design, privacy and ethics.
